Frozen Strawberry Yogurt Clusters

Frozen Strawberry Yogurt Clusters: A Guilt-Free Delight

Enjoy these Frozen Strawberry Yogurt Clusters, a guilt-free delight perfect for a refreshing snack.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Freezing Time 2 hours
Total Time 2 hours 10 minutes
Servings: 4 clusters
Course: Snacks
Cuisine: Healthy
Calories: 70

Ingredients
  

For the Base
  • 2 cups Fresh Strawberries Chopped into small pieces.
  • 1 cup Plain Greek Yogurt Plain to avoid added sugars.
  • 2 tablespoons Honey Can be substituted with maple syrup.
For Flavor
  • 1 tablespoon Freshly Squeezed Lemon Juice Fresh is best but bottled works in a pinch.
  • 1 teaspoon Pure Vanilla Extract Avoid imitation for the best taste.

Equipment

  • Mixing Bowl
  • Spatula
  • Baking Sheet
  • Parchment Paper
  • tablespoon

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Wash strawberries thoroughly under cold water, hull, and chop them into small pieces.
  2. In a mixing bowl, combine Greek yogurt, honey, lemon juice, and vanilla extract. Whisk until smooth.
  3. Gently fold in the chopped strawberries to the yogurt mixture.
  4. Scoop portions of the mixture onto a lined baking sheet.
  5. Freeze for at least 2 hours until solid.
  6. Remove clusters from the sheet and store in an airtight container in the freezer.

Notes

For best results, use ripe strawberries and allow sufficient freezing time for texture.
